About Us
Auckland City Hospital is committed to upholding Te Tiriti o Waitangi and providing culturally safe care. Our Pharmacy department is an innovative and exciting place to work, employing over 100 staff including those working within two retail pharmacies and a flagship inpatient service.
The Role
In this role, you will have the opportunity to join New Zealand's leading oncology and haematology specialists and research nurses, providing clinical pharmacy expertise to complex oncology and haematology outpatients. You will contribute to the development of protocols, prescriptions, and guidelines, and educate and train pharmacists and the wider multidisciplinary team.
Your Skills and Experience
You must have a keen interest in haematology/oncology and be passionate about putting patients at the centre of everything you do. You should have experience in reviewing chemotherapy prescriptions and liaising with specialist clinicians to ensure safe and cost-effective delivery. Postgraduate clinical qualifications and haematology and/or oncology experience are desirable.
